Sotheby’s Partner with Savile Row Tailor Huntsman & Sons

This May, Sotheby’s will partner with esteemed Savile Row tailor Huntsman & Sons to stage its first online-only luxury lifestyle sale.

Featuring an array of bespoke pieces from the private collection of Huntsman owner and financier, Pierre Lagrange, alongside commissioned new works that exemplify the Huntsman lifestyle, this collection reflects Lagrange’s expert knowledge and appreciation of exquisite objects.

The sale will offer a view into the life and passions of Pierre Lagrange as a custodian to Huntsman’s unique heritage, which has attracted discerning patrons throughout the ages.

Lot 5: HUNTSMAN BESPOKE BACKGAMMON JACKET | Amba Jackson

Huntsman Sothebys 037.JPG

I'd possibly say this is something I'd not only consider bidding on, but something I'd consider masterminding some elaborate heist for. Designed by Amba Jackson the rock and roll star’s granddaughter and designer and a keen amateur of the board game in her own right.

No one wants to schlepp a backgammon board game around whilst on set. Amba worked with Huntsman's creative team to produce a unique board design printed on the inside lining of creative director Campbell Carey’s black linen travel jacket, transforming it into a wearable backgammon set. 

The prototype offered to the winner of this lot is available in size 36, however the buyer's size can be accommodated upon request. ESTIMATE:  £2,000 - £3,000

Who is Pierre Lagrange? 

Pierre Lagrange is the owner and executive chairman of Huntsman & Sons, one of the world’s oldest and most sought after names in bespoke tailoring, and custodians of a craft dating back to 1849 when the store was established on Bond Street in London. Lagrange acquired Huntsman in 2014 with a view towards growing the 169 year old bespoke business globally.
